Transaction db23b44ebe52ce985d02ea7ff1db0868c1707c19143600b206b1bfcad498ea6b
1 Input
1 Output
-
db23b44ebe52ce985d02ea7ff1db0868c1707c19143600b206b1bfcad498ea6b:0
- value
- 475388
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 763322dee9d0b5c49711870229c38fd8cfb90cee OP_EQUAL
- address
- 3CTzvBkYAtBfPWoykqoByhuBE1NThhptNA